A lovely family is seeking a caring Part-time Nanny in Finchley, London. The ideal candidate will support their baby, prepare nutritious meals, and maintain a clean and safe environment.
Working up to 30 hours a week, candidates must be first-aid qualified and confident in childcare responsibilities. The family is looking for someone who can start in May 2026. This is an excellent opportunity to work in a nurturing home environment.

How to prepare for a job interview at Little Ones UK Ltd
✨Know Your Childcare Basics
Make sure you brush up on your childcare knowledge before the interview. Be ready to discuss your experience with babies, including feeding routines and sleep schedules. This will show the family that you're confident and capable in handling their little one.
✨Highlight Your First-Aid Skills
Since being first-aid certified is a must, be prepared to talk about your training and any real-life situations where you've had to use those skills. This will reassure the family that their baby will be in safe hands.
✨Show Your Nurturing Side
During the interview, let your caring personality shine through. Share examples of how you've created a warm and safe environment for children in the past. The family wants someone who can provide a nurturing atmosphere for their baby.
✨Ask Thoughtful Questions
Prepare some questions to ask the family about their routines, preferences, and expectations. This shows that you're genuinely interested in their needs and helps you understand if it's the right fit for both sides.
